The Bible is a Lamp or a Light
The Bible uses the illustration of itself being a Lamp or a Light.
Psa 119:105 Thy word is a lamp unto my feet, and a light unto my path.
Try walking in the dark and you will find it is not easy. You are full of doubt and you are unsure of where you are and where you are going. I did some walking and even cross country skiing in the dark when I was young and foolish. High in the Rocky Mountains with no towns nearby it is dark. It can be really dark. And walking only barely being able to see the path not only causes you to be unsure about that step you are taking but it can be dangerous. There could be a hole in the trail, or a root sticking up or some other obstacle. More than once I got hurt or in trouble because I could not see where I was going.
God does not want our spiritual lives to be like that. He wants us to be able to see clearly so that we can know where to go and so we can see the dangers ahead. Walking in the light helps us avoid a whole lot of hurt, troubles and dangers.
Psa 119:105 Thy word is a lamp unto my feet, and a light unto my path.
The Bible is a lamp unto my feet. That refers to where I am right now. My immediate surroundings. His word gives us light to where we are in life right now. And it is a light unto my path. That refers to where I am going. What is ahead of me. God’s Word gives us direction both for the right now and for what is ahead. There are many paths you can take in life. In fact there are more paths out there than we can name or identify. They are without number. Which one should I take in life. Which path will lead me to have a better life. Which path is more pleasing to God.
The answer is the path that God’s Word lights for us.
Psa 119:130 The entrance of thy words giveth light; it giveth understanding unto the simple.
We will go into that verse deeper another week. I really love this one. It starts out, The entrance. If you let it in, the Bible will give light, it will give understanding unto the simple. No PHD. Required. God loves everyone and wants everyone to benefit from His light.
2Pe 1:19 We have also a more sure word of prophecy; whereunto ye do well that ye take heed, as unto a light that shineth in a dark place, until the day dawn, and the day star arise in your hearts:
The Bible was given to us by a loving God for our benefit. We do well when we take heed to what it says. When we see it as a light that shines for us to illuminate the dark that is all around us. We have darkness all around and sometimes we have darkness in our own hearts.
Jer_17:9 The heart is deceitful above all things, and desperately wicked: who can know it?
We need the light of God’s word, and we need to allow it to show us our way and yes we need it to illuminate the dark places in our hearts when we get off track.
